Essential Welding Techniques in Argentina

Understanding the essential welding techniques is crucial for anyone involved in soldadura argentina. The choice of technique often depends on the materials being joined, the project requirements, and the welder's skill level. Let's delve into some of the most common welding methods used in Argentina. Shielded Metal Arc Welding (SMAW), commonly known as stick welding, is one of the most widely used techniques due to its versatility and cost-effectiveness. It involves using a coated electrode to create an arc between the electrode and the base metal, melting both to form a weld. SMAW is particularly popular for its simplicity and ability to be used in various environments, including outdoor settings and on thick materials. However, it requires a skilled welder to produce clean and consistent welds.

Gas Metal Arc Welding (GMAW), also known as MIG welding, is another prevalent technique in soldadura argentina. GMAW uses a continuously fed wire electrode and a shielding gas to protect the weld from contamination. This method is known for its speed and efficiency, making it suitable for production environments. It can be used on a variety of metals, including steel, aluminum, and stainless steel. The learning curve for GMAW is relatively gentle, but achieving high-quality welds still requires practice and expertise. Gas Tungsten Arc Welding (GTAW), or TIG welding, is renowned for producing high-precision, high-quality welds. It uses a non-consumable tungsten electrode to create the arc, and a shielding gas protects the weld area. GTAW is particularly useful for welding thin materials and dissimilar metals. While it is a slower process compared to SMAW and GMAW, the resulting welds are exceptionally clean and strong. GTAW requires a high level of skill and control, making it a favorite among experienced welders.

Submerged Arc Welding (SAW) is an efficient technique typically used for welding thick materials in automated or semi-automated processes. In SAW, the arc and weld area are submerged under a layer of granular flux, which prevents spatter and suppresses fumes. This method produces high-quality welds with deep penetration, making it ideal for heavy industrial applications. Flux-Cored Arc Welding (FCAW) is a versatile technique that can be used with or without a shielding gas, depending on the type of flux-cored wire. FCAW is often used in construction and shipbuilding due to its high deposition rate and ability to weld in windy conditions. Safety Standards and Practices

Safety is paramount in any welding environment, and soldadura argentina is no exception. Adhering to strict safety standards and practices is essential to prevent accidents and ensure the well-being of welders. One of the most critical safety measures is wearing appropriate personal protective equipment (PPE). This includes a welding helmet with an auto-darkening lens to protect the eyes from the intense light and radiation produced during welding. Welding gloves made of durable leather are necessary to protect the hands from burns and sparks. A welding jacket or apron made of flame-resistant material is also crucial to protect the body from heat and spatter.

Eye protection is non-negotiable when dealing with soldadura argentina. The intense ultraviolet (UV) and infrared (IR) radiation emitted during welding can cause severe burns to the eyes, a condition known as arc eye or welder's flash. A welding helmet with the correct shade of lens will filter out these harmful rays, preventing eye damage. Additionally, wearing safety glasses or goggles underneath the welding helmet provides an extra layer of protection against debris and sparks. Respiratory protection is another critical aspect of welding safety. Welding fumes can contain harmful particles and gases that can cause respiratory problems and long-term health issues. A respirator, either a disposable N95 mask or a more advanced powered air-purifying respirator (PAPR), should be worn to filter out these contaminants. Proper ventilation in the welding area is also essential to minimize the concentration of fumes.

Fire safety is a major concern in welding environments. Welding produces sparks and hot materials that can easily ignite flammable substances. Therefore, it is crucial to clear the welding area of any combustible materials before starting work. Having a fire extinguisher readily available is also a must. Regularly inspecting welding equipment for damage or wear is another important safety practice. Damaged equipment can malfunction and pose a significant risk to the welder. Ensuring that all electrical connections are secure and that grounding is properly installed can prevent electric shock. Training and Certification Programs

To excel in soldadura argentina, comprehensive training and relevant certifications are essential. These programs ensure that welders have the necessary skills and knowledge to perform their jobs safely and effectively. Numerous institutions and organizations in Argentina offer welding training programs, catering to different skill levels and specialization areas. One of the primary pathways to becoming a certified welder in Argentina is through vocational training schools. These schools typically offer courses that cover various welding techniques, safety practices, and material science. The curriculum is designed to provide students with a solid foundation in welding principles and hands-on experience in different welding processes.

Many technical colleges and universities in Argentina also offer welding programs as part of their engineering or technology degrees. These programs provide a more in-depth understanding of welding metallurgy, design, and quality control. Students learn about the underlying principles of welding and how to apply them in real-world applications. Apprenticeship programs are another valuable option for aspiring welders in soldadura argentina. These programs combine on-the-job training with classroom instruction, allowing apprentices to learn from experienced welders while earning a wage. Apprenticeships typically last several years and provide a comprehensive education in all aspects of welding.

Certification is a crucial step in demonstrating competence as a welder in Argentina. Several organizations offer welding certifications, including the Argentine Welding Institute (IAS) and other internationally recognized bodies. These certifications validate that a welder has met specific standards of skill and knowledge. The certification process typically involves passing a written exam and a practical welding test. The practical test requires the welder to perform welds on specific materials and in specific positions, which are then inspected to ensure they meet the required quality standards. Different certifications are available for different welding techniques and materials. For example, a welder may be certified in SMAW, GMAW, GTAW, or other processes, and may also be certified to weld specific materials such as steel, aluminum, or stainless steel. Maintaining certification often requires ongoing training and periodic retesting to ensure that welders stay up-to-date with the latest techniques and standards.
